Method for detecting and controlling battery status by using sensor, and electronic device using same

1. An electronic device comprising:
a housing;
an accommodator disposed in the housing and including at least one gas sensor;
a battery disposed in the housing;
a display;
a memory configured to store information of gas, which leaks from the battery, sensed by the at least one gas sensor and operation control information of the electronic device; and
a processor electrically connected with the memory,
wherein the processor is configured to:
obtain a sensing signal of the gas leaking from the battery using the at least one gas sensor,
control, when the obtained sensing signal of the gas exceeds a first threshold, the display to notify a user via a user interface that the obtained sensing signal of the gas has exceeded the first threshold, and
block, when the obtained sensing signal of the gas exceeds a second threshold, signals for performing at least one function of the electronic device.
